staging.inyokaproject.org

Aus Java drucken - Bug; Lösung?

Status: Ungelöst | Ubuntu-Version: Ubuntu 8.04 (Hardy Heron)
Antworten |

xrolly

Avatar von xrolly

Anmeldungsdatum:
26. September 2007

Beiträge: 4322

Hallo UUsers, das Drucken aus Java-Programmen scheint noch immer ein Problem zu sein:

YED-Graphischer Editor –> Programmstart –> Hilfe-Datei ausdrucken, erstes Problem (Errormeldung) –→ Neustart –> Arbeitsschritte, ohne Probleme –> ausdrucken gleiche Problem

java.lang.NullPointerExeption: null attribute
	at sun.print.IPPPrintService.isAttributeValueSupported(IPPPrintService.java:1147)
	at sun.print.ServiceDialog$OrientationPanel.updateinfo(ServiceDialog.java:2121)
	at sun.print.ServiceDialog$PagaSetupPanel.updateinfo(ServiceDialog.java:
	at sun.print.ServiceDialog.updatePanels(ServiceDialog.java:)
	at sun.print.ServiceDialog.initPrintDialog(ServiceDialog.java:)
	at sun.print.ServiceDialog.<init>(ServiceDialog.java:)
	at javax.print.ServiceUI.printDialog(ServiceDialog.java:188)
	at sun.print.RasterprinterJob.printDialog(RasterprinterJob.java:856)
	at sun.print.PSPrinterJob.printDialog(PSPrinterjob.java:421)
	at com.sun.java.help.impl.jHelpPrintHandler$PrintThread.run(JHelpPrintHandler.java:460)

Der letzte Satz und Google brachten mich nach hier: Bug ID: 6633656 Cross platform print dialog doesn't check for ... letzte Meldung zu diesem Thema:

bugs.sun.com Submitted On 02-JUN-2008 FeriW just tested with java6_10 build 22. confirmed to be fixed in this build

just tested with java6_10 build 24 on linux mandriva 2008 (kernel version 2.6.24.4-desktop-1mnb) , that is true that the print dialog is shown BUT when we press print button, the printer process just stopped and did not print anything.

Jemand schon eine Lösung oder Tipp wie man das umgehen kann, um aus Java Programmen zu drucken (Kommandozeile, *.ps/*.pdf etc. 😬)❓.

Dank vorraus, netten Gruß, xrolly

aasche

Anmeldungsdatum:
30. Januar 2006

Beiträge: 14259

Wird denn mit Sun Java 5 gedruckt? Oder benoetigt yED unbedingt (Sun) Java 6?

xrolly

(Themenstarter)
Avatar von xrolly

Anmeldungsdatum:
26. September 2007

Beiträge: 4322

Hallo @aasche, wie bekomme ich heraus mit welcher Java-Version yed druckt?

:~$ dpkg -l java*
Desired=Unknown/Install/Remove/Purge/Hold
| Status=Not/Installed/Config-f/Unpacked/Failed-cfg/Half-inst/t-aWait/T-pend
|/ Err?=(none)/Hold/Reinst-required/X=both-problems (Status,Err: uppercase=bad)
||/ Name           Version        Beschreibung
+++-==============-==============-============================================
ii  java-common    0.28ubuntu3    Base of all Java packages
un  java-gcj-compa <keine>        (keine Beschreibung vorhanden)
un  java-gcj-compa <keine>        (keine Beschreibung vorhanden)
un  java-runtime   <keine>        (keine Beschreibung vorhanden)
un  java-runtime-h <keine>        (keine Beschreibung vorhanden)
un  java-virtual-m <keine>        (keine Beschreibung vorhanden)
un  java2-runtime  <keine>        (keine Beschreibung vorhanden)
un  java2-runtime- <keine>        (keine Beschreibung vorhanden)
un  java5-runtime  <keine>        (keine Beschreibung vorhanden)
un  java5-runtime- <keine>        (keine Beschreibung vorhanden)
un  java6-runtime  <keine>        (keine Beschreibung vorhanden)
un  java6-runtime- <keine>        (keine Beschreibung vorhanden)

Das habe ich noch gefunden, es wird auch der bug genannt:

java druckt nicht unter ubuntu 710 Damit man trotzdem drucken kann, muss man entweder

  • die Seitendrehung von "automatisch" auf einen festen Wert stellen

  • CUPS auf eine ältere Version umstellen

Wenn ich CUPS auf eine ältere Version umstelle entstehen mir Nachteile/Probleme, wenn ja welche?

Netten Gruß, xrolly

xrolly

(Themenstarter)
Avatar von xrolly

Anmeldungsdatum:
26. September 2007

Beiträge: 4322

Hallo

Ungültiges Makro

Dieses Makro ist nicht verfügbar

Users, schon jmd. eine Loesug des Problems gefunden?

Netten Gruss, xrolly

Antworten |